@media only screen and (min-width:960px){/styles for browsers larger than 960px;/.menu-large .col-md-2-5{width:20%;margin:0;padding:0;}
}
@media only screen and (min-width:1440px){/styles for browsers larger than 1440px;/.menu-large .col-md-2-5{width:20%;margin:0;padding:0;}

}
@media only screen and (min-width:2000px){/for sumo sized (mac) screens/}
@media only screen and (max-device-width:480px){/styles for mobile browsers smaller than 480px;(iPhone)/.mobile-pagespeed-frame{background-image:url(../images/pagespeed-mobile-frame.png);background-position:center center;height:463px;max-width:226px;margin:0 98px;width:100%;}
}
@media only screen and (device-width:768px){/default iPad screens/

    h1 {
        font-size: 34px;
    }
}
/different techniques for iPad screening/@media only screen and (min-device-width:481px) and (max-device-width:1024px) and (orientation:portrait){/For portrait layouts only/}
@media only screen and (min-device-width:481px) and (max-device-width:1024px) and (orientation:landscape){/**For landscape layouts only**/

}

@media (max-width:1440px){
}

@media (max-width:1366px){

}
@media (max-width:1200px){
}

@media (max-width:1280px){

    .hide-desktop {
        display: block;
    }

    .show-desktop {
        display: block;
    }
    .navbar-nav > li > .dropdown-menu {
        width: 151%;
        left: -42%;
    }
}

@media (max-width:1024px){

    .navbar-default .navbar-nav > li > a {
        padding: 0 12px;
        font-size: 20px;
        line-height: 45px;
    }
    .secondary-header {
        background-color: transparent;
        background-repeat: no-repeat;
        height: auto;
        background-size: cover;
        background-image: url(../images/header-bg.jpg);
        background-position: top center;
    }

    .navbar-expand-lg .navbar-nav .nav-link {padding: 5px 8px; font-size: 12px;}

    .navbar-nav > li > .dropdown-menu {
        width: 145%;
        left: -39%;
    }

    .dropdown:hover>.dropdown-menu a, .dropdown-menu a {
        font-family: 'Ford-Antenna-Light';
        font-size: 12px;
        line-height: 22px;
    }
}

@media (max-width:1199px){
    div.submit-container{float: none;}
    .menu-large .col-md-2-5{width:20%;margin:0;padding:0;}
    .pagination {
        display: inline-block;
        padding: 0px 421px;
        margin: 20px 0;
        border-radius: 4px;
    }
}

@media (min-width:1200px) {
    .slick-slide img.slider-mobile{display:none;}
    .hide-desktop{display:none;}
    .pagination {
        display: inline-block;
        padding: 20px 0px 0px 820px;
        margin: 20px 0px;
        border-radius: 4px;
    }

}
@media (max-width:1200px){	
    .navbar-default .navbar-nav > li > a {
        padding: 0 12px;
        font-size: 20px;
        line-height: 45px;
    }
    .secondary-header {
        background-color: transparent;
        background-repeat: no-repeat;
        height: auto;
        background-size: cover;
        background-image: url(../images/header-bg.jpg);
        background-position: top center;
    }
}

@media(max-width:1280px){

}

@media(max-width:1024px){

}
/*iPad Pro (12.9") Start*/
/* Portrait and Landscape */
@media only screen 
and (min-width: 1024px) 
and (max-height: 1366px) 
and (-webkit-min-device-pixel-ratio: 1.5) {
}

/* Portrait */
@media only screen 
and (min-width: 1024px) 
and (max-height: 1366px) 
and (orientation: portrait) 
and (-webkit-min-device-pixel-ratio: 1.5) {
}


@media(max-width:991px){
    .navbar{position:relative;}
    input.input-directions, .directions-btn{width:100%;}
    .menu-large .col-md-2-5{width:20%;margin:0;padding:0;}
    .slick-slide img.mobile{display:none;}
    .slick-slide img.desktop{display:block;}
    .hide-desktop{
        display:none;
    }
    .navbar-default .navbar-nav > li > a {
        padding: 0 17px;
    }

    .navbar{background:#000;}
    footer, footer a {height: auto;}
}

@media (min-width:812px){
    .navbar-right .dropdown-menu{right:0;left:0;}
    footer a{line-height:44px;}
    .navbar-right{float:right!important;margin-right:-15px;}
    .slick-slide img.slider-mobile{display:none;}
    .slick-slide img.slider-desktop{display:block;}
    .hide-desktop{
        display:none;
    }	
}

@media (max-width:812px){
    .menu-large .col-md-2-5{width:33.3%;margin:0;padding:0;}
    .slick-slide img.slider-mobile{display:none;}
    .slick-slide img.slider-desktop{display:block;}
    .pagination {
        display: inline-block;
        padding: 20px 293px;
        margin: 20px 0px;
        border-radius: 4px;
    }

    .modal-viewsample {
        width: 95%;
    }	

    /* Navbar New */	
    .list-mobile {width: 100%; margin-top: 20px;}
    .header-info {margin: 15px auto;}
    ./*navbar img {max-width: 200px; margin:0 auto;}*/
    .navlist {width: 100%;}
    .navlist button {float: right; border: 1px solid #ccc;}

    .logo {
        flex: 0 0 100%;
        max-width: 100%;
    }

    .navlist {
        width: 100%;
        flex: 0 0 100%;
        max-width: 100%;
    }	

    .navbar-collapse {
        border-top: 1px solid #ccc;
        margin-top: 50px;
    }	

    .navbar{background:#FFF;}


    #testimonials img,
    #m-testimonials img  {margin-bottom: 20px;}

}



@media (max-width:768px){

}

@media (max-width:767px){
    ul.hide-mobile {
        display:none !important;
    }

    .megamenu{margin:0;position:relative;}

    .megamenu> li{margin-bottom:0px;}
    .megamenu> li:last-child{margin-bottom:0;}
    .megamenu.dropdown-header{padding:3px 15px !important;}
    .nav>li{clear:both;position:relative;}
    .navbar-nav>li>.dropdown-menu{margin-top:0;}
    .megamenu> li > ul > li > a img{display:none;}
    .mobile-text{display:block;}
    .navbar-nav>li>a.dropdown-toggle{display:block;}
    .navbar-nav>li>a.hide-mobile, .navbar img.hide-mobile{display:none;}
    li.hide-desktop{display:block;}
    .img-portfolio{margin-bottom:15px;}
    .navbar-inverse .navbar-nav>li>a{height:45px;line-height:45px;}
    .phone-license-social{text-align:center;float:left;width:100%;}
    .mobile-menu-design-modern .mobile-selector{text-align:left;}
    .mobile-nav-item{position:relative;font-size:12px;line-height:normal;}
    .navbar{position:relative;}
    .navbar-brand{width:100%;margin:0 auto;padding:0 0 10px;overflow:hidden;}
    .navbar-brand img{width:auto;}
    .navbar-toggle{margin-top:-45px;}

    .navbar-right {
        float: left !important;
        margin-right: -15px;
        margin-top: 0px;
    }

    .logo-center{float:right;}


    .menu-large .col-md-2-5{width:auto;margin:0;padding:0;}
    .navbar-default .navbar-nav .open .dropdown-menu>li>a{color:#777;width:378px;}
    .slick-slide img.slider-mobile{display:block;}
    .slick-slide img.slider-desktop{display:none;}

    .easyPaginateNav {
        width:100% !important;
    }
    .pagination>a {
        display: inline;
    }

    .pagination:first-child>a {
        margin-left: 0;
        border-top-left-radius: 4px;
        border-bottom-left-radius: 4px;
    }

    .pagination>a:focus, .pagination>a:hover, .pagination>span:focus, .pagination>span:hover {
        z-index: 2;
        color: #23527c;
        background-color: #eee;
        border-color: #ddd;
    }
    .pagination>a, .pagination>a>span {
        position: relative;
        float: left;
        padding: 6px 12px;
        margin-left: -1px;
        line-height: 1.42857143;
        color: #337ab7;
        text-decoration: none;
        background-color: #fff;
        border: 1px solid #ddd;
    }	

}

@media (max-width: 430px){
  .section-header {
    padding-top: 80px;
    padding-bottom: 80px;
    background-position: right center;
    }
}

@media (max-width:540px){

    /* Nav Start */
    .header-phone {
        width: 100%;
        margin: 0 auto;
        text-align: center;
    }
    .list-mobile {
        margin-top: 0;
    }

    .btn.btn-login {width: 100%;}

    .header-phone {
        margin: 0px auto;
        text-align: center;
    }

    .pnum {display: block;}

    .nav-header {
        background-image: url(../images/header-bg.jpg);
        background-position: center center;
        background-repeat: no-repeat;
        padding: 30px 0px 10px;
    }
    .navbar-toggler {
        padding: 4px 7px;
    }
    .navbar img.logo {
        width: 100%;
        margin: 0 auto;
    }
    .navbar-nav {padding-top: 10px;}

    .mega-footer li {
        font-size: 14px;
        line-height: 18px;
        margin-bottom: 10px;
    }
    .hide-mobile {
        display:none !important;
    }
    .navlist {
        padding-right: 15px;
        padding-left: 15px;
        margin-top: -50px;
        margin-bottom: 0;
    }

    .navbar-nav > li > .dropdown-menu {
        padding: 15px;
        width: 100%;
        left: 0;
        top: 0;
    }
    .dropdown-item:focus, .dropdown-item:hover {
        color: #99C8FB;
        background-color: transparent;
    }
    .dropdown:hover > .dropdown-menu a {
        font-family: 'Ford-Antenna-Light';
        font-size: 12px;
        line-height: 18px;
        border:none;
    }
        .dropdown:hover > .dropdown-menu a span {
            margin-bottom: 10px;
        }
    .dropdown-menu { 
        background-color: transparent;
    }
    .dropdown-menu .row [class*="col-"] { 
        margin-bottom: 15px;
    }


  .menu-large .dropdown-menu {text-align: left;}
    
    .section1 h1,
    .section2 h2,
    .section3 h2,
    .section4 h2,
    .section5 h2,
    .section-form h2 {
        font-size: 40px;
        line-height: 50px;
    }

    .section-form .contact {
        padding: 30px;
    }

    .section-form {
        padding:50px 0px;
    }

    .parallax-contact-us .form-header h2 {
        font-size: 40px;
        line-height: 50px;
    }
    .parallax-contact-us .contact {
        margin-bottom: 30px;
    }

    .parallax-contact-us h2 {
        font-size: 32px;
        line-height: 42px;
    }

    .parallax-contact-us .contact {
        padding: 30px;
    }

    .mega-footer img {
        margin: 0 auto 20px;
        max-width: 300px;
        display: block;
    }
    .mega-footer .logo {
        text-align: center;
        margin-bottom:  20px;
    }

    .mega-footer p, .mega-footer h3, .mega-footer .social-icons {
        text-align: center;
    }

    .mega-footer h2 {
        font-size: 30px;
        line-height: 40px;
    }

    .mega-footer img.logo-footer {
        padding-bottom: 30px;
        width: 132px;
        margin: auto;
    }

    .mega-footer ul {
        padding-bottom: 20px;
    }

    .mega-footer .side-border {
        border-width: 2px 0px 0px 0px;
        padding: 20px 0px;
        margin: 0px 20px;
    }

    #btn-submit {white-space:normal;}
    .slick-slide img.slider-desktop{display:none;}
    .slick-slide img.slider-mobile{display:block;}
    .hide-mobile {
        display:none;
    }

    .hide-mobile {
        display: none;
    }
    .hide-desktop {
        display: block;
    }
.section1 h3 {
    font-size: 30px;
    line-height: 40px;
    }

.section1 h2 {
    font-size: 22px;
    line-height: 32px;
    }
      .section1 .btn-success {
    font-family: 'Montserrat-Regular';
    font-size: 20px;
    color: #fff;
    background-color: #65B859;
    border: none;
    margin:20px auto;
    padding: 8px 30px;
    border-radius: 0px;
  }
}

@media (max-width: 375px){
	.section1 h2 {
    font-size: 22px;
    line-height: 32px;
    }
}


@media (max-width: 320px){
.section1 h2 {
    font-size: 22px;
    line-height: 32px;
    }

}
